Transaction 873df0e820dcf39a055215d4af30d0d1d8e2351f32153f0a3532650168ff7e90
2 Input
2 Outputs
- 873df0e820dcf39a055215d4af30d0d1d8e2351f32153f0a3532650168ff7e90:0
- 873df0e820dcf39a055215d4af30d0d1d8e2351f32153f0a3532650168ff7e90:1
value 952025
address 1HBRS26HH6GFPPpacwsWh8EdMQvMcgU95A
value 18954960
address 1AKvFvGFW9tUPqf96CMAk42YhEYEsak3YD